London, UK —June 26, 2025 — Jumper Exchange has integrated support for Etherlink, bringing cross-chain accessibility to the high-performance Tezos Layer 2 blockchain. The integration will enable users to bridge assets to and from Etherlink to more than 50 networks, starting with Ethereum Mainnet, Arbitrum, and Base.

Jumper Exchange is a one-stop platform that enables swapping and bridging across 50+ chains. Powered by LI.FI, it provides users with the best rates by aggregating liquidity from bridges, DEX aggregators, and intent-based systems. The platform combines liquidity across 22 bridges and 16 DEXs to ensure optimal execution paths for supported assets and has facilitated nearly $20 billion in volume to date.

“We’re excited to bring Etherlink into our multi-chain ecosystem,” said Ali Al-Ali, Product Manager at Jumper Exchange. “Etherlink’s combination of EVM compatibility and Tezos security makes it a natural fit for our platform. Our users can now access this high-performance Layer 2 with the same transparent, zero-fee experience they expect from Jumper.”

At launch, users will be able to bridge to and from Etherlink from Ethereum Mainnet, Arbitrum, and Base through Jumper Exchange. The integration supports Etherlink’s EVM compatibility, ensuring seamless interaction with existing Ethereum tools, wallets, and indexers. Users can access the bridging functionality by visiting the Jumper website and selecting Etherlink as their destination or source chain. The Jumper integration expands Etherlink’s existing bridging infrastructure, which includes the EVM Bridge for wrapped assets and the Tezos Bridge for connecting with L1.

The timing aligns with significant momentum in the Etherlink ecosystem. In recent months, total value locked (TVL) on Etherlink has surged to beyond $40M, demonstrating growing developer and user adoption. Recent improvements to network performance include the successful deployment of the Dionysus and Calypso upgrades.

About Etherlink

Etherlink is an EVM-compatible Layer 2 blockchain powered by Tezos Smart Rollups technology. It empowers developers to smoothly deploy any EVM codebase and migrate users and assets from Ethereum and other interoperable chains, enabling seamless interaction and asset transfers across different networks.
